Spragia Family Vineyards, Dry Creek Valley, Andolsen Vineyard, Cabernet Sauvignon 2006 The nose features Cassis and a touch of the forest floor, a light green element adding complexity and a nice dash of vanilla. In the mouth it is muscular and youthful, quite tannic and longing for a sleep in the cellar. With 30 minutes the fruit really starts to shine – nice.
5% of the grapes are Cabernet Franc. The wine was aged for 19 months in 100% French oak barrels. Vinted and bottled in St. Helena 14.9% purchased for $27.99 at Bottle Barn
